Lady Gators play in Edgewood tourney
      The Clarke Prep School Lady Gators went 1-2 in the Edgewood Invitational Tournament this past weekend in Wetumpka. In their last game they were edged 7-3 by Macon-East. Jessica McKinley, Tess Ackerman and Whitney Gavin each had a hit. Anna Hicks had two RBI.

Lady Bulldogs open season with two wins
      The Clarke County High School Lady Bulldogs opened the 2008 softball season this past weekend by going 2-2 in the Andalusia Invitational Tournament. In the last game they lost 13-3 to the Lady Aggies of Jackson last Saturday.

Jordan-Hare Stadium is Alabama's number one sports destination
      Approximately 677,500 people attended a football game at Jordan Hare Stadium in Auburn last year, ranking it number one in attendance among sports venues in Alabama.
